Climb the ancient stone steps to Murugan Temple, where colourful carvings and devoted pilgrims create an atmosphere of spiritual wonder. Nearby rock-cut caves reveal intricate sculptures from the 8th century, while local vendors offer fragrant jasmine garlands and traditional Tamil sweets.
The hottest months are usually April and May, with an average temperature of 31°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 26°C. Average annual precipitation for Thiruparankundram is 1069 mm.
